1. A Vision of a Smart City

Dubai launched its “Smart Dubai” initiative in 2014 with a clear mission: use technology to deliver a better life for its citizens and a competitive edge for its economy. It was built on three pillars—digital services, smart infrastructure, and data-driven governance. The result is a city where parking sensors in streets, real‑time public transport updates, and instant digital ID verification work together to make the city feel almost effortless.

3. Blockchain: From Payments to Property

Dubai’s embrace of blockchain goes beyond financial services. The Dubai International Financial Centre (DIFC) launched a fully regulated token exchange, and the city’s land registry uses blockchain to ensure a tamper‑proof record of ownership.

3.1 Tokenization of Real Estate

The concept of tokenizing property allows investors to buy fractional shares of high‑value assets. This democratizes access to real estate markets and instantly parallels the liquidity seen in stock exchanges.

3.2 Transparent Governance

All data on public contracts, procurement, and government spending is stored on an immutable ledger. Stakeholders can audit records in real time, reducing corruption and increasing confidence in the city’s institutions.

Data‑Driven City Management

One of the most visible signs of Dubai’s digital future is its data‑driven city management. Every street, every utility, every parking space is monitored by a network of sensors, cameras and AI algorithms. By collecting real‑time information, the city can respond to problems before they become noticeable to everyday residents. For instance, when a traffic jam begins to form on a main artery, traffic lights can automatically adapt to create smoother flows. When air quality dips below a safe level, the city can issue alerts and deploy public‑transport adjustments to keep people safe.

City officials say that these systems are learning as they go. By feeding historical data into machine‑learning models, Dubai’s planners can predict peaks in demand, optimize waste collection routes and even suggest the best locations for new business districts. Jiang, an assistant researcher at the Dubai Institute of Data Science, explains, “What we’re seeing is a breakthrough in predictive governance.”

Blockchain: Secure and Transparent Governance

Blockchain goes beyond cryptocurrencies in Dubai. It is being used to build transparent, tamperproof records for everything from building permits to citizen IDs. A citizen can verify that a building’s safety testing was performed by an approved contractor simply by scanning a QR code on the building’s facade. Civil engineers in the city’s municipal office can instantly confirm compliance with international safety standards.

Besides public administration, blockchain is also disrupting real‑estate investment. The city’s land registry now uses distributed ledger technology so that property ownership records are immutable. This technology has lowered fraud and increased buyer confidence, especially for foreign investors who are looking for stable, trustworthy markets.

Smart Energy Management

Dubai’s move toward smarter energy consumption mirrors its transportation agenda. Solar farms now supply a substantial portion of the city’s grid. However, the real difference lies in how that energy is distributed. Each smart meter reports usage patterns to a central cloud platform that can balance supply and demand on the fly. If a sudden spike occurs in the evening, the platform can reroute excess solar power to smart homes, reducing the need for costly peak‑time purchases from the national grid.

Homeowners also have control through the same centralized dashboard: they can set their HVAC systems to power on during off‑peak hours or pause smart appliances during peak needs. Citizens can also participate in “energy sharing” programs, where households can sell surplus power back to the grid through smart contracts.

The Triple‑Layered Approach

Dubai’s technological strategy is organised into three layers:

  • Infrastructure Layer – 5G networks, smart grids, autonomous vehicles and sensor‑laden streets.
  • Data Layer – Open APIs, blockchain ledgers, and AI models that analyse urban traffic, energy use and citizen sentiment.
  • Application Layer – Services for mobility, health, safety and commerce that are delivered through mobile apps and smart kiosks.
